
Fish fertilizer makes the soil fertile. It provides the plants with the necessary nutrients that help them grow easily and stay healthy. It contains a good amount of potassium, nitrogen and phosphorus.
It is made from fish bones, skin and soil. Useless fish are buried in the soil in the garden or field. In a few days, the fish mix with the soil and become manure. This manure makes the soil of the field and garden fertile. Flowers and fruit trees bear more fruits and flowers.
Apart from eating fish, it is also used in medicines, cosmetic products and fertilizers. In America, before growing corn, fish were kept in the soil. Due to rotting of fish, the crop grew rapidly. Its use gradually started all over the world.
